The CEO of Pret A Manger warned that prices at his chains may go up due to food inflation but hasn't ruled out additional pay increases for his workers.
Pano Christou explained that he knows what it's like for workers to struggle on low wages due to his upbringing in a low-paid household.
It comes after the CEO confirmed a third wage rise for his chain's staff members within a year. He highlighted that the pay rise was fair for his workers and that he wants the business to stand out against its competitors, the Mirror reports.
